Few careers are more exciting than those in the domain of international trade. Dynamic, fast-paced, and cosmopolitan, you would be hard-pressed to find a more exhilarating professional pursuit-and for those of us with a penchant for travel and learning new things, hardly anything could be more thrilling.

But how to break into such a wide-ranging, ever-changing domain? Enter A Career in International Trade - Living the Dream, a practical introductory guide to the thrilling arena of international trade. Drawing on his decades-long experience as a trade practitioner alongside the accounts of over twenty modern-day professionals involved in cross-border commerce, author Marvin Hough sketches the contours of the essential issues for someone to consider when entering the field, from more enduring questions-like those around bridging cultural and linguistic difference-to more timely concerns, such as dealing with supply chain disruptions.

Some of the key issues addressed include . . .

- The unique-and uniquely accessible-opportunities available in international trade, including travelling the world, learning new languages and cultures, and broadening one's overall perspective
- The wide variety of career options in the industry, from market researcher to risk manager, company accountant to trade lawyer
- The skills necessary to keep up in this competitive arena, and ways to continually hone them-including industry-respected programs and certifications
- The nature of the fast-moving changes currently shaping and expected to shape the field into the future

With its practical focus, A Career in International Trade - Living the Dream is the perfect helpful, educative resource for anyone looking to break into the electrifying world of international trade.
